SA President Ramaphosa promises land redistribution talks South African President Cyril Ramaphosa has reassured the country of fears of land grabs following a parliamentary vote on expropriation without compensation. Addressing the house of traditional leaders in parliament, President Ramaphosa said the process of land redistribution should be handled with care. Mr. Ramaphosa, who is seen as a business-friendly leader went on to argue that the process should be equitable. He said the sins that were committed when the country was colonised must be resolved, saying as it is being resolved it must be done in a way that will take South Africa forward.
